colourless salt `(A) underset(740^(@)C) overset(Delta)to (B) +(C ) overset(Cu^(2+),Delta)to` blue coloured bead (D)
Identify the compound (A),(B),(C ) and (D).

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

`underset((A))(Na_(2)B_(4)O_(7)).10H_(2)O underset(740^(@)C) overset(Delta)to underset((B+C))(2NaBO_(2))+B_(2)O_(3) overset(Cu^(2+), Delta)to underset(("Blue bead"))(Cu (BO_(2))_(2))`
